Unlike stationary homes, RVs need a power system that is compact, lightweight, durable, and capable of delivering consistent energy across various conditions. From powering lights, fans, and refrigerators to charging electronics and running water pumps, an RV battery must support a wide range of daily needs while remaining efficient and safe during motion, vibration, and temperature fluctuations.
1. Lightweight and Space-Saving
Space is a premium in RVs, and every kilogram counts. LiFePO4 batteries are about 50–70% lighter than lead-acid batteries of the same capacity. This allows RV owners to save weight and free up space for other essentials — all while increasing energy efficiency.
2. Long Cycle Life
Traditional lead-acid batteries may offer 300–500 cycles before significant capacity loss. In contrast, LiFePO4 batteries typically deliver over 3000 cycles and often up to 6000+ when discharged properly. This means years of reliable power, even with daily use.
3. Fast Charging and High Efficiency
LiFePO4 batteries accept higher charge currents, allowing them to recharge more quickly from solar panels, alternators, or shore power. They also maintain a steady voltage throughout their discharge cycle, which helps protect sensitive electronics and appliances.
4. Deep Discharge Capability
Unlike lead-acid batteries, which should only be discharged to 50% to maintain lifespan, LiFePO4 batteries can be safely discharged to 80–90%. This increases usable capacity per charge and extends time between recharges — a major benefit when camping off-grid.
5. Built-In Safety
LiFePO4 chemistry is inherently safe. It’s resistant to overheating, doesn’t vent toxic gases, and doesn’t pose a fire or explosion risk. Most units also include a built-in Battery Management System (BMS) that protects against overcharging, overcurrent, and extreme temperatures.

Voltage and Capacity
Choose the right setup based on your power needs:
12V 100Ah: Common for small to medium RVs.
24V or 48V systems: Ideal for higher loads or when using powerful inverters.
Parallel connection: Add multiple batteries to increase total capacity.
Charging Sources
Solar Panels: A typical RV setup includes rooftop solar charging via an MPPT charge controller.
Alternator Charging: Use a DC-DC charger while driving to recharge from the engine.
Shore Power: Connect to campsite electricity through a lithium-compatible inverter/charger.

While LiFePO4 batteries have a higher upfront cost, their extended lifespan and reduced maintenance result in a lower total cost of ownership over time. They are also non-toxic, recyclable, and help reduce dependence on fossil fuels when paired with solar — supporting sustainable RV travel.
